I think they are BA, but in the past I have had success in stuffing an M3 tap through and using an M3 screw....
when I did this I was "vizarding" the carb, cutting away the top half of the spindle, countersingking the butterfly, and slimming the rmaining (threaded ) part of the spindle. I would skrew the butterfly on and grind the screw flush woth the spindle, then reasemble in the carb with loctite and use a centrepunch to stake the screw intpo the spindle.

The butterfly screws are 1/8 inch Whitworth thread, this has 40 tpi.
The American UNC 5-40 thread is very close to the 1/8 Whitworth.
